<br /> <br /> <br />Item No: 6A <br />Meeting Date: June 17, 2015 <br />Type of Business: Other Planning Activity <br /> <br />City of Mounds View Staff Report <br /> To: Planning Commission <br /> From: Heidi Heller, Planning Associate <br />Item Title/Subject: Review Code Amendment to Allow Additional Materials on the <br />Exterior of Columbaria on Religious Institution Properties <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/>The City Council recently adopted Ordinance 899 that allows columbaria at churches. Due to <br />the large increase in cremations rather than burials, more places are needed to store urns. <br />Mounds View does not currently have any cemeteries, and the City Code did not address <br />columbaria, so language was added to specifically allow and add some requirements for <br />columbaria. The Planning Commission did not want to allow brick on the exterior of the <br />columbaria out of concern for it not being maintained long-term. The ordinance was passed <br />with language that did not allow brick. The Mounds View church that is planning to install <br />columbaria would like to put brick on the exterior since it will be against their building, which is <br />brick, and has requested that the ordinance be amended to allow brick exteriors. Staff met <br />with the church members and were given more information and examples of how it is common <br />to use matching brick on the columbaria at churches. The City Council is supportive of making <br />an amendment to allow brick on the exteriors of columbaria. Staff has also added bronze as <br />an allowed exterior material. <br /> <br />Recommendation <br />Review Resolution 1031-15 with the proposed language for a code amendment relating to the <br />allowed materials on the exterior of columbaria. <br /> <br /> <br />Sincerely, <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Heidi Heller, Planning Associate <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Attachments: <br />1.
